
Building a StoryBrand
by Donald Miller · Published 2017
For anyone working in marketing it offers a simple, usable framework: brand messaging should be built around the customer's problem, not the company itself. A little oversimplified, but practical to apply.
What works
- Very easy to understand.
- Immediately applicable to marketing.
- Excellent messaging framework.
- Particularly useful for websites and landing pages.
What doesn't
- Simplifies branding.
- Not a complete marketing strategy.
- The framework can feel formulaic when overused.
- Doesn't address positioning and competitive strategy deeply enough.
Customers understand brands more easily when the customer is positioned as the protagonist and the company as the guide helping them solve a problem.
